Navigating Opportunities in Software Development

Sean Mehrabi
20 Aug 2025

Explore how emerging technologies like AI and Cloud are transforming software jobs and how Mars Innovations Technologies can catalyze your growth.

The Changing Landscape of Software Development Careers

The realm of software development is experiencing unprecedented transformation driven by rapid technological advancements. The traditional roles of developers and engineers are expanding to encompass expertise in artificial intelligence, cloud computing, automation, and data science. As businesses increasingly rely on digital solutions to stay competitive, the demand for skilled professionals with proficiency in these emerging areas continues to surge.

In this evolving environment, software development jobs are no longer confined to coding and debugging. They now include designing intelligent systems, managing cloud infrastructures, implementing DevOps practices, and ensuring cybersecurity. This shift presents both opportunities and challenges for professionals seeking to adapt and thrive in the new digital economy. Companies are looking for versatile talent capable of integrating multiple technologies seamlessly to develop innovative products and services.

For businesses, staying ahead requires not just hiring skilled developers but also fostering an ecosystem of continuous learning, agility, and technological adoption. As a result, organizations like Mars Innovations Technologies are investing heavily in training, research, and partnerships to remain at the forefront of this dynamic landscape.

The Rise of Artificial Intelligence in Software Development Jobs

Artificial Intelligence has transitioned from a futuristic concept to a core component of modern software solutions. AI-driven tools now assist developers in writing code, testing applications, and diagnosing bugs more efficiently. Machine learning algorithms can analyze vast datasets to generate insights, automate decision-making, and personalize user experiences.

For software professionals, AI presents opportunities to specialize in areas like natural language processing, computer vision, and predictive analytics. Developers can build intelligent chatbots, recommendation engines, and autonomous systems that transform industries such as healthcare, finance, and retail. Companies integrating AI into their offerings gain a competitive edge by delivering smarter, more adaptive products.

Mars Innovations Technologies recognizes the importance of AI and actively develops proprietary AI platforms and APIs. By providing clients with tailored AI solutions, the company helps businesses automate complex processes, improve customer engagement, and unlock new revenue streams. The company's commitment to AI-driven innovation positions it as a leader in the digital transformation journey.

Cloud Computing: The Backbone of Modern Software Careers

Cloud technology has revolutionized how software is developed, deployed, and maintained. Cloud platforms like Amazon Web Services, Microsoft Azure, and Google Cloud enable developers to access scalable infrastructure, storage, and services on demand. This flexibility accelerates development cycles, reduces costs, and enhances collaboration across distributed teams.

For software development jobs, cloud proficiency is now a fundamental skill. Professionals must understand cloud architecture, containerization tools like Docker and Kubernetes, and serverless computing paradigms. Knowledge of DevOps practices and CI/CD pipelines further enhances their ability to deliver high-quality, reliable applications rapidly.

Mars Innovations Technologies leverages cloud solutions to create resilient, flexible software architectures. Its expertise in cloud migration, hybrid cloud strategies, and cloud security ensures clients can innovate without compromise. The company’s cloud-first approach helps clients achieve operational agility and respond swiftly to market changes, making it a critical enabler in expanding software offerings.

The Role of Automation and DevOps in Accelerating Software Projects

Automation has become integral to streamlining software development workflows. Continuous Integration and Continuous Deployment (CI/CD) pipelines automate testing, building, and releasing software, reducing manual effort and minimizing errors. DevOps practices foster closer collaboration between development and operations teams, ensuring faster delivery and higher quality products.

Professionals skilled in scripting, automation tools, and cloud integration are highly sought after. They can design pipelines that automatically detect issues, rollback faulty releases, and deploy updates seamlessly. This not only shortens development cycles but also enhances the robustness and security of applications.

Mars Innovations Technologies offers comprehensive DevOps consulting and automation solutions. By implementing tailored CI/CD pipelines, infrastructure as code, and monitoring systems, the company helps clients accelerate innovation, improve reliability, and reduce operational costs. This strategic focus accelerates business growth and positions clients for long-term success in competitive markets.

Cybersecurity: Safeguarding the Future of Software Development

As digital solutions proliferate, cybersecurity has become a critical aspect of software development. Protecting sensitive data, ensuring user privacy, and maintaining system integrity are paramount. Developers now need to integrate security principles into every stage of the software lifecycle, a practice known as DevSecOps.

Jobs in cybersecurity encompass threat modeling, vulnerability assessment, and implementing security protocols within code. With cyber threats becoming more sophisticated, there is a growing demand for experts capable of designing secure architectures, conducting penetration testing, and developing security automation tools.

Mars Innovations Technologies emphasizes a security-first approach in all its projects. Its team of cybersecurity specialists collaborates with clients to implement end-to-end security measures, ensuring compliance with regulations like GDPR and HIPAA. This proactive stance not only mitigates risks but also builds trust and brand reputation, crucial for expanding business in the digital age.

How Mars Innovations Technologies Facilitates Business Growth Through Technology

Mars Innovations Technologies is uniquely positioned to help businesses harness the power of modern software development technologies. Its strategic focus on AI, Cloud, automation, and security enables clients to innovate rapidly and scale efficiently. The company offers end-to-end solutions—from consulting and architecture design to implementation and ongoing support—ensuring seamless integration into existing workflows.

By investing in cutting-edge research and maintaining a highly skilled talent pool, Mars Innovations Technologies helps clients stay ahead of industry trends. Its tailored approach ensures that each solution aligns with specific business goals, whether launching a new product, migrating to the cloud, or implementing AI-driven analytics.

Furthermore, the company fosters partnerships with leading technology providers, giving clients access to the latest tools and platforms. This collaborative ecosystem accelerates development timelines and reduces costs, creating a competitive advantage. As digital transformation continues to reshape industries, Mars Innovations Technologies’ expertise becomes a vital catalyst for growth.

Embracing Continuous Learning and Adaptation in a Rapidly Evolving Field

Success in the software development arena depends heavily on continuous learning and staying updated with the latest technological advancements. The rapid pace of innovation demands that professionals and organizations invest in ongoing training, certification, and knowledge sharing.

Mars Innovations Technologies promotes a culture of learning through workshops, hackathons, and partnerships with educational institutions. This emphasis on skill development ensures its team remains at the forefront of emerging technologies, ready to deliver innovative solutions to clients. For businesses, adopting a similar mindset is crucial for maintaining relevance and competitive edge in a fast-changing landscape.

The future of software development jobs will be characterized by adaptability, interdisciplinary expertise, and a proactive approach to technological evolution. Companies that embrace these principles will not only survive but thrive amid disruption.

Building a Future-Proof Software Ecosystem

Creating a future-proof software ecosystem involves more than just adopting the latest technologies; it requires strategic planning, scalability, and resilience. Cloud-native architectures, microservices, and containerization are vital components that enable systems to evolve without extensive rework.

Mars Innovations Technologies assists organizations in designing such resilient ecosystems

Tags:
Software Development
Share:
FaceBookLinkedinTwitter

Sean Mehrabi

Chief Executive Officer


Article

Read Our Lates News

Find out about the latest in Tech and how we can help you grow.

View All
Navigating the Software Odyssey: Transforming Ideas into Impact with Modern Development Strategies
26 Aug 2025
View All

Get Free
Infrastructure Assessment

[email protected]

2025 Willingdon Ave #936, Burnaby, BC V5C 3Z3